Today I am sharing a Bereavement Card I made for a friend, on the passing of her mother last week.  A little eclectic shabby chic but loved creating it with special features of remembering Dora.

She loved flowers and fashion and when I first met her some 30 plus years ago she was enjoying a game of Housie (Bingo).
 I have used Marian Smith patterned papers and mixed this with flowers, trinkets lace and some very old vintage bead trim from my stash.
